The second best advice I'd give is you're probably holding yourself back. Learn the basics (present/past/future tenses, common words) and just start speaking. You can spend years learning every little thing about grammar and sentence structure and whatever, but if you want to learn quick just speak and get feedback. If you screw something up someone will correct you and you'll have internalized 5x better then if you read it. You don't need to understand 100%, but try and recognize the words you do know within a sentance and go from there. You'll pick everything else up in time, but the most fun part of language learning is finally being able to communicate fluidly. You'll sound stupid for a bit, but so does everyone.
